This restaurant incident highlights the delicate balance between customer expectations and server challenges in high-pressure service roles. Dr. Amy Cuddy, a social psychologist, notes, “Unconscious biases or past experiences can shape interactions, but professionalism demands equal treatment” (Harvard Business Review). The waitress’s behavior—ignoring the man while engaging only with his girlfriend—suggests a potential issue, possibly discomfort with men or a misguided service tactic, but it undermines the basic courtesy expected in her role.

The man’s decision to escalate to the manager was a valid response to feeling disrespected, especially after being outright ignored when requesting the bill. A 2023 study found that 72% of customers expect equal attention from servers regardless of gender (Journal of Service Research). However, the girlfriend’s point about possible trauma introduces nuance—servers with personal struggles may need accommodation, but not at the expense of basic job duties. The manager’s reprimand reflects accountability, though potential firing raises questions about proportionality.

Dr. Cuddy advises addressing service issues directly with the server first, if possible, to clarify intent before escalating. The man could have asked the waitress politely about her behavior, though her ignoring him made this difficult. For others in similar situations, calmly asserting one’s needs while being open to underlying reasons can prevent escalation while ensuring respect. The man’s complaint wasn’t malicious but a push for fair treatment, though the outcome may weigh heavier than intended.
